Description of the Nectarine Note

Nectarine in perfumery is a juicy and sunny fruity note that imparts a sense of freshness, sweetness, and carefree joy to fragrances. Unlike its velvety cousin, the peach, nectarine has a smoother and brighter skin, which in olfactory terms often translates into a clearer, more watery, and refreshing note. It is ideal for creating summer, joyful compositions that evoke a mood of celebration and warmth.

Olfactory Profile of the Nectarine Note

The aroma of nectarine in perfumery is an explosion of juicy sweetness with a refreshing tartness. It is less oily and heavy than peach, more reminiscent of the crisp flesh of a ripe fruit, bursting with juice. As a typical fruity note, nectarine most often occupies a place in the top notes or heart of the fragrance pyramid, responsible for the first bright impression. Its longevity is moderate, but it perfectly sets the tone for the entire composition, making it immediately recognizable and attractive.

Origin and Extraction of the Note

Interestingly, nectarine is not a hybrid, but a natural variation of peach with smooth skin, obtained through selection. In the perfume industry, natural nectarine absolute is rarely used due to the complexity of extraction. Therefore, perfumers such as Christine Nagel or Dominique Ropion recreate its characteristic scent using synthetic aromatic molecules that accurately convey the juicy, appetizing sweetness of freshly picked fruit.

What Notes Pair Well with Nectarine

Thanks to its versatility, nectarine harmonizes beautifully with other fruity notes, such as apple, apricot, or blackcurrant, creating juicy chords. It also combines excellently with floral hearts—peony, jasmine, freesia—adding captivating sweetness. For more interesting contrasts, perfumers, for example Jean-Claude Ellena or Olivier Cresp, may pair it with light woody or musky bases to balance the fruity brightness.
